Conflation queues replace messages with new one as they arrive if the two messages share the same key value
A conflation queue is created if you specify a <conflationKey> in the XML configuration; or provide a value for x-qpid-conflation-key in the arguments to the Queue.Declare command.
A queue thus created will check incoming messages as they come in for the value in the application headers associated with the given conflationKey. Any message with the same conflation key value which has not yet been dequeued will be dequeued immediately as the new message is inserted into the queue.
Using a non-acquiring consumer (i.e. browsing) one can use a conflation queue as an LVQ which also sends updates as new values are inserted/updated.
